Parliament-Funkadelic: Influences

George Clinton and his band of psychedelic groovers amalgamated many of the trends of '60s music into something strange and new. They took James Brown's fiery funk and the charged-up rock of Sly & The Family Stone and gave it a looser, more cosmic feel, while mixing Isaac Hayes' languid beats with the absurd weirdness of The Mothers of Invention to create outer-space bombs that still felt tuned to the rhythms of the earth.
